That model, if I'm not mistaken, is still not on the Vintage list, so you SHOULD be able to call Apple and get a replacement set of media. Figure on ~$20US give or take. I would call immediately though, because very soon that unit will pass into vintage status, and that will limit your options somewhat.
Then I would suggest burning a copy (or three) of the replacement media they send you. And of course if you have a copy of 10.5, you can just install that. You don't need 10.4 to be installed first.
After starting the process of restoring the computer with the discs it gets stuck on disc #2. The #2 disc is scratched and can't be fixed is there any other way to repair this problem? Please help... it had tiger loaded
